Ottawa, Ontario, CANADA – January 30, 2018 – Arvizio, Inc., announces the integration of dense point cloud scans from DotProduct 3D scanners with the MR Studio™ mixed reality software platform. MR Studio is an enterprise level solution designed to provide a comprehensive mixed reality experience including complex 3D model visualization, real-time collaboration and data integration utilizing Microsoft HoloLens and other mixed reality devices.

Industries such as AEC, Energy, Industrial Design, Surveying, Mining and Oil and Gas employ a variety of 3D scanning tools to construct large and complex point cloud models which may involve millions or even billions of points. DotProduct’s hand held scanning devices capture 3D scenes in the form of point cloud models which HoloLens, or other wearable headset devices, are unable to render directly due to the high density of points. Arvizio’s MR Studio Director ingests highly compressed, DotProduct binary DP data and prepares the data automatically for visualization in mixed reality.
